Types of Eco Fabrics and Their Characteristics

When it comes to choosing a sustainable t-shirt, the fabric matters significantly.

Understanding the types of eco fabrics available can help you make choices that resonate with your values.

Here’s a look at some popular eco fabrics and what they say about you:

### Organic Cotton
• Soft and Comfortable: Made from cotton that is grown without harmful pesticides or synthetic fertilizers, organic cotton is gentle on your skin and the planet.

– Eco-Friendly: By choosing organic cotton, you’re helping to support sustainable farming practices that promote biodiversity.

• Certifications: Look for GOTS (Global Organic Textile Standard) certified fabrics, which ensure the cotton is produced sustainably and ethically, protecting the workers’ rights as well as the environment.

### Recycled Polyester
• Resource Efficient: Derived from recycled plastic bottles, this fabric reduces waste in landfills and uses fewer resources compared to virgin polyester.

– Durable: Recycled polyester is known for its high durability, allowing your t-shirt to withstand the test of time (and saves more resources in the long run!).

– Versatile: It can be blended with other materials for added stretch and performance.

### Tencel (Lyocell)
• Biodegradable: Made from sustainably sourced wood, Tencel is fully biodegradable and produced in a closed-loop process that minimizes waste and water use.

– Breathe Easy: It’s incredibly breathable and moisture-wicking, perfect for those warm summer days or intense workouts.

– ECO-Friendly Certification: Look for Tencel fabrics that carry OEKO-TEX certification, ensuring they are free from harmful substances.

### Hemp
• Super Sustainable: Hemp is a fast-growing crop that requires minimal water and no pesticides, making it an incredibly eco-friendly alternative.

– Durable and Strong: Hemp fabric is renowned for its strength and durability, often becoming softer with each wash.

– Natural UV Protection: This fabric naturally offers UV protection, making it a great choice for outdoor enthusiasts.

#### Why Organic Cotton Matters
Organic cotton is grown without harmful pesticides or synthetic fertilizers, making it better for the environment and your skin.

Here are some benefits of organic cotton:
• Reduced Toxicity: Free from harmful chemicals, organic cotton is gentler on skin, making it a great option for those with sensitivities.

– Water Conservation: The farming process requires significantly less water than conventional cotton, which is crucial as we face global water shortages.

– Biodiversity: Organic practices support the ecosystem, allowing various plants and animals to thrive, and promoting a healthier planet.
